In Indian homes, where vibrant hues are celebrated, you can mix and match colours to reflect your personality while ensuring that the overall aesthetic remains balanced. Here are some of the best colour combinations that can elevate your home design.1. Earthy Tones and Greens: Pairing earthy tones like terracotta, beige, or taupe with various shades of green can create a soothing and natural atmosphere. This combination works well in living rooms and bedrooms, offering a sense of calmness and serenity.2. Royal Blue and Gold: For a touch of luxury, consider combining royal blue with gold accents. This combination exudes elegance and sophistication, perfect for drawing attention in dining rooms or entryways.3. Pastel Shades: Soft pastel colours like mint green, blush pink, and lavender can create a dreamy vibe. These shades work beautifully in children's rooms or for a light-hearted approach in the living area.4. Grey and Yellow: A combination of cool grey with bright yellow can add a modern twist to any space. This pairing is ideal for kitchens or home offices, where you want a blend of professionalism and warmth.Tips for Choosing the Right Colour CombinationsWhen selecting your colour palette, keep these tips in mind:Consider the size of the room. Lighter colours can make a small space feel larger, while darker shades can create a cozy atmosphere.Use the 60-30-10 rule: 60% of the room should be a dominant colour, 30% a secondary colour, and 10% an accent colour.Test your colours in natural light to see how they change throughout the day.FAQQ: What are the best colours for a small living room?A: Light colours like whites, creams, and soft pastels help make a small living room feel more spacious. Consider adding pops of colour with accessories.Q: How can I incorporate bold colours without overwhelming my space?A: Use bold colours in smaller doses, such as through cushions, artwork, or a feature wall, to add character without overpowering the room.Home Design for FreePlease check with customer service before testing new feature.
